Sign in

Test Project Manager

Saint-Laurent, QC, Canada
October 22, 2018

Contact this candidate



: +1-514-***-****


A decisive, self-motivated and result driven professional with over 10 years of experience across IT Test Management, Defect Management, Stakeholder Management in onshore & offshore model.


Domain expertise: Salesfource CRM, e-Learning, Network Security, Mobile(iOS and Android) Applications, Windows device drivers for Storage and USB protocols

Expertise in Web based applications testing, Mobile application (iOS, Android), Network and security products, e-Learning products, CRM products, risk management planning and mitigation

Expertise in designing Test strategy/ approach, testing scope, entry/ exit criteria for various phases of testing, including integration testing, system integration testing and User acceptance testing

Oversee and govern the test execution cycles with internal team and with customer through to the project closure

Assist Test Automation specialists in building the automation framework and script development using Selenium tool

Work with client in defining performance requirements/ goals and then assist Performance test specialists in defining test scripts, workload model in jMeter tool for performance testing

Test Management on projects following Agile methodology (Scrum process): Establishing and enforcing standard test processes & deliverable (including defect management and quality metric reporting) within the gated process to streamline testing and support automation and manual testing efforts

Worked as Test consultant to build business proposals to develop end to end Test automation solution

Facilitated scrum activities including sprint planning, sprint review, retrospectives, and daily scrums

Remove obstacles for the team and/or direct obstacles to appropriate owners for quick resolution for each project

Understand long-term product planning/ roadmap and help inform development teams to create quicker gains for the benefit of the end user

Build relationship with Product owner and other stake holders to facilitate team's interaction with them

Continuously learned Agile/Scrum techniques and shared findings with the team

Provided all support to the team using a servant leadership style whenever possible, and led by example

Team Management: Leading multiple Test Team (Manual, Automation both Functional and Performance)


Testing Tools:

Network security testing: Hping, Nmap, Pref, Metasploit, Wireshark tools

Mobile Network simulation testing: Charles tool

Load and performance testing: Apache jMeter

Android application security testing: Package Play, Manifest Explorer, Intent Fuzzer, Intent Sniffer tools

Memory leak testing of Mobile applications: XCODE - Instrument tool

Functional automation of Mobile applications: Fone Monkey, Robotium, Sikuli tools

Windows device drivers testing: Microsoft Windows Test Technology.

Defect Management and Test Management tools: JIRA, Bugzilla, TestRail, Testlodge

Configuration Management Tool: SVN, GitHub, Visual Source Safe,

Programming Language and scripting: Basics of C, Core Java, Batch scripting, VB scripting

Operating System Platform: Windows 7/Vista/XP, Linux, Mac

Soft skills: Collaborator, Communicator, Thinker, Innovator

Awarded as “Excellence in Learning Application” in 2012 at Harbinger Systems Pvt. Ltd.

Awarded as “Excellence in Software Quality” in 2009 at Harbinger Systems Pvt. Ltd.

Awarded “Best Project” to my team in 2013 at Harbinger Systems Pvt. Ltd.

Certified ScrumMaster CSM® in 2017.

Diploma in Web-Design (Part Time) from Navigant Technologies in 2002.

Mobile application testing techniques

Building consultative behavior in client facing roles.

Attended emerging leadership workshop at Harbinger group. Awarded A grade completion certification.


PG Diploma (MBA) in IT Management from Symbiosis University, Pune in 2014.

Diploma in Computer Engineering with First class (64%) from the CUSROW WADIA INSTITUTE OF TECHNOLOGY, Pune in 2006.

Worked as Test Lead with Harbinger Group, Pune, India from March 2008 to March2015 and Dec 2017 to Feb 2018.

Worked as Software Test Engineer with Epicomm Technologies Ltd. Pune from April 2006 to February 2008.

Worked Onsite with Microsoft Corporation® Redmond, USA for 1 year.

Test Lead - Harbinger Group,Pune - India March 2008 to Feb 2018

Major Projects worked on:

1.Member of Project Management review board: e-Learning Project

Client - RedVector, USA

Duration - July 2017- Feb 2018

Representing Project Manager wearing customer hat

Project internal kick-off Study Kick-off meeting MOM

Scoping: Study SOW, understand assumptions explicitly, understand exclusions explicitly, Create WBS w.r.t. QA activity

Estimation: Work out the estimate with the help of functional experts/self, ensure that time for any non-functional testing is considered appropriately; raise a need of tech. forum help to PM, if needed

Hold Stand-up meeting: Control schedule to ensure timely deliveries, Judge & Escalate risks to PM, verify the approach of Testing is correct and the most optimal; if not mention the same to PM with reasons formally

2.Test Consultant: e-Learning Project

Client - Wisewire, USA

Duration - April 2017- July 2017

Key responsibility on this assignment is to understand the application and build a business proposal to develop automation test scripts to test complete end to end application

Understand and define the scope in coordination with the client business team

Evaluate multiple automation tool and provide comparison study

Define Test approach and plan, including efforts estimation and resource requirements

3.Test Lead as well as consultant: HR Domain Project

Client - Peoplise, Turkey –Europe

Duration - May 2017- July 2017

Test Management - Creation of Test Strategy (functional manual and automation), Test Plan, Test Estimation, Test completion Report single handedly. And sole responsible for all test deliverables.

Defect Management – Following up with Test team on each phase of a defect and CR raised and getting implemented. Tracking them till closure.

Build effective QA status dashboards for executive reporting, to highlight quality status, achievements, risks which helped in taking informed decisions.

4.Project and QA Lead: Salesforce CRM

Client – Versium, USA

Duration - Dec 2016- April 2017

In this project, I was leading development team, UI/UX team and QA team.

Understand the Salesforce core features like Accounts, Campaigns, Opportunities, Reports, Leads, lists, etc. and analyze the new requirements provided by customer to integrate "Predict" application and its features with Salesforce.

Derive robust Test plans to validate the new functionality of "Predict" application and its integration with Salesforce.

Ensure appropriate test coverage from UI and cross platform (browsers, devices) perspective.

Review test plans, test cases, compatibility matrix with customer and incorporate their feedback.

Share the test results, reports, quality dashboards with customer on regular (weekly, daily) basis.

For non-functional testing/ performance testing; discuss and define the testing requirements and approach with the client. This includes identify the goal and objective of performance testing, target throughput, expected response time, etc.

Work with performance test specialist to setup the test environment (load generators with necessary configuration) and defining scripts, workload models in jMeter tool

Consolidate the execution readings/ graphs and present the report to the client and other stakeholders

5.Test Lead: Network and Security

Client: TaaSera, Inc., USA

Duration - June 2012- Oct 2014

Reporting to Project Manager and direct interaction with Client.

Create/design Test Strategy, Detail Test Plan for functional and non-functional testing (performance, load testing)

For each deliverable, identify the test environment and set up test environment (such as setting up repository server (using MYSQL database), security tools set up

Research and evaluate on various network security tools for network Penetration Testing. Prepared network Penetration Testing plan.

Identify testing types and approaches on various modules of the product

Build a testing team of professionals with appropriate skills, attitudes and motivation.

Identify Training requirements and arrange it for team members to maintain/update skill set.

Ensure the timely delivery of different testing milestones

Communicate with Client on regular basis to synch up on testing progression.

6.Test Lead: iOS and Android Mobile Applications

Client - CloudFront, USA

Duration - Jan 2011- June 2012

Reporting to Client CTO of the client Organization.

Prepared Test strategy for manual, automation testing, API testing, security testing, performance testing

Define Testing process and phases in Agile methodology in JIRA

Configured various automation tools for iOS and Android testing and executed it on various applications.

Responsible for client-side QA team management and leading them and groom them on various tasks and areas.

Worked on performance testing on iOS application. Discovered potential memory leaks and allocation issues for iOS applications.

HTML5 mobile browser compatibility (Tested on Safari and Opera Mini browser)

Preparing testing checklist (Messaging, Connectivity, Multimedia, Browser Call handling, Battery Consumption, Unmapped keys) for mobile applications.

Developed and executed load test script scenarios based on the business requirements and specifications.

7.Associate Test Lead: Microsoft Windows OS Device Drivers Testing

Client- Microsoft Inc., Redmond-USA

Duration - March 2008 - Dec 2010

Setting up Test environment (at offshore lab), this includes, gathering hardware requirement based on devices (test devices and 1394 PCI chipset cards) from different vendors.

Create test estimations plans

Use testing tools like Devcon, driver and application verifier, WDF verifier, power test etc.

Automate test scenarios using Microsoft’s WTT (Windows Test Technology) tool and report issues through Microsoft’s Product Studio.

Create tools to automated manual tasks such as download test builds, upload results, and prepare test machines (play with registry settings) with pre-requisite applications and settings using command line scripting. Automate OS installation process using ASI (Automated software installer) tool.

Attend bug triage meetings with Project managers and Test leads.

Worked onsite at Microsoft Corporation® Redmond, USA for 1 year (2008-2009)

Software Test Engineer - Epicomm Technologies Ltd. Pune, India April 2006 to Feb 2008

Worked on project (PayPal transactions)

Was there since requirement gathering, R&D on requirements

Prepared SRS documents, Proposal documents

Was involved Database design

Set-up the QA process

Presenting test plans and test strategy to customers

Perform test education (training)

Testing and consultant preparing requirement documents

Languages Known : English

Visa : Canada –Open Work Permit

Address : Apartment 406, 1100 Rue Goulet, Saint-Laurent, Montreal, H4R 2C6

Email :

I hereby declared that the details provided above are true to the best of my knowledge.


Place: Montreal (PALLAVI AGRAWAL)







Contact this candidate